Review: New York Herald, 21 May 1867, 7.

“Mr. Theodore L’Arronge has lost none of his popularity at this establishment, to judge from the manner in which the capital burlesque Ten Girls and No Husband is still received.  In this amusing trifle he gives full vent to his humor and eccentric style of acting, and manages to keep his audience in a broad grin from first to last.  Mr. Dawson appears for the last time in America to-night in the character of King Lear.”
